Takin' the 'ump.

Padarn Bus Dennis Dart / Plaxton J989 JNJ negotiates the hump backed river bridge in the centre of Beddgelert as it sets off for Caernarfon a couple of Saturdays ago. The tidy looking machine had been new to south coast operator Brighton Buses in 1992 and still looks very presentable here. Is it just me though, or could you be forgiven for thinking Padarn Bus is part of the Stagecoach empire?

The sign (finger) post part way across the bridge is potentially confusing for unsuspecting motorists as the directions it refers to are actually in the foreground rather than immediately past it as convention dictates. Anyone turning left for Capel Curig on the far side of the river would be in for a nasty surprise as it's a cul-de-sac ... albeit a pretty one.
